TimeEvaluator

Struct TimeEvaluator 

Source
pub struct TimeEvaluator { /* private fields */ }
Expand description

Evaluates whether the current bloop’s timestamp falls within a specified time window.

The TimeEvaluator checks if the recorded_at time of a bloop, converted to a configured timezone, matches the given hour and/or minute, allowing for an optional leeway duration.

§Behavior

  • If hour is Some, it checks if the time’s hour equals.
  • If minute is Some, it checks if the time’s minute equals.
  • If either hour or minute is None, that component is ignored (i.e., any hour or minute matches).
  • The time window starts at the exact configured hour/minute (or current hour/minute if None), and extends forward by the leeway duration.
  • Handles daylight saving time ambiguities by selecting the earliest matching local time.
  • If the configured time does not exist on the day (e.g., during a DST gap), evaluation returns false.

impl TimeEvaluator

Source

pub fn new( hour: Option<u32>, minute: Option<u32>, timezone: Tz, leeway: Option<Duration>, ) -> Result<Self, Error>

Creates a new TimeEvaluator.

§Examples
use std::time::Duration;
use bloop_server_framework::evaluator::time::TimeEvaluator;

let evaluator = TimeEvaluator::new(
    Some(12),
    None,
    chrono_tz::Europe::Berlin,
    Some(Duration::from_secs(60))
).unwrap();
